1. Beat the Summer Humidity with Moisture Control
Queensland’s sticky summers can lead to mould, mildew, and musty smells—especially in bathrooms, laundry areas, and wardrobes.
DIY Moisture-Busting Tips:
Open windows on breezy days for natural ventilation.
Run bathroom/kitchen exhaust fans for 15–20 minutes after use.
Use moisture absorbers like baking soda, salt jars, or store-bought options.
Wipe bathroom tiles weekly using a 1:1 vinegar and water spray to prevent mould.

2. Seal and Insulate for a Pest-Free Winter
As the temperature drops, pests like rodents and cockroaches seek warmth inside your home.
DIY Prevention:
Inspect and seal gaps around doors and windows using silicone or weather stripping.
Repair torn fly screens to keep pests out while letting air in.
Clear gutters and garden beds to prevent damp areas that attract pests.

3. Refresh Carpets, Curtains, and Upholstery
Soft furnishings trap dust, allergens, and bacteria over time—especially during closed-window months in winter.
DIY Cleaning Checklist:
Vacuum carpets and upholstery weekly using a HEPA-filter vacuum.
Steam clean carpets during dry summer days to kill dust mites and refresh fibres.
Sun-dry cushions, doonas, and pet beds for a natural deodorising and mite-killing effect.

4. Declutter and Organise to Reduce Hiding Spots for Pests
A tidy home is a less inviting place for pests to hide or breed.
DIY Decluttering Tips:
Clear out cardboard boxes, paper stacks, and cluttered corners—common nesting areas for cockroaches and rodents.
Store pantry goods in airtight containers, including pet food.
Trim trees and bushes that touch or overhang your roof or windows.
5. Improve Comfort and Efficiency with Better Insulation
Smart insulation doesn’t just keep your home more comfortable—it also lowers your energy bills.
Quick DIY Fixes:
Add door snakes or foam weather seals to doors and windows.
Install thermal curtains to retain heat in winter and block sunlight in summer.
Reverse ceiling fan direction in winter (clockwise) to push warm air down.
6. Follow a Seasonal Home Care Checklist
Consistency is key to avoiding mould, dirt, or pests catching you off guard.
DIY Seasonal Checklist:
Season | Tasks |
Summer | Clean AC filters, check for mould, inspect tile grout. |
Winter | Seal gaps, clean carpets, declutter storage areas. |
Spring | Deep clean surfaces, check for insect activity, clean curtains. |
Autumn | Wash flyscreens, trim gardens, inspect for water damage. |
